They oppose the twinning of the Transmountain pipeline from Edmonton to Burnaby, BC which Trudeau's government have already said yes to..
It would send another 890,000 barrels per day of diluted bitumen to the West Coast where it will be exported to Asia..
The original piepline has been in production since 1953 and has a capacity of about 300,000 barrels per day.

I work in the old and gas industry. Even if Justine tried to speed it up, shovels will not go into the ground right away. And it will not be built in 2019 as Kinder Morgan had hoped.
Each delay leaves companies that will be be keeping the pipeline filled wavering in their commitment to the project. Kinder Morgan isn't going to spend money unless they have assurances suppliers are on side. Suppliers won't continue to commit unless they are sure the damned thing will get built or even make economic sense when they have a reliable partner South of the border to invest in.
I don't even think even the Enbridge Line 3 expansion which Justine's government also approved will be built before the next federal election. Canada is falling behind economically.
